Juice Plus Complete Peanut Butter Bars

2 Cups Natural Peanut Butter (I use Smucker’s Reduced Fat)
1 ¼ cup honey
½ cup agave nectar
2-¼ cup chocolate complete powder (vanilla works too)
3 cups oats (I use Quaker 1 or 5 minute oats)

Mix all ingredients in large bowl.  May have to use hands to mix.  Spread in 9 x 13 pan.  Refrigerate.  Cut into 64 squares.

NUTRITION FACTS

Serving size:                        1 square
Calories                        106.0
Total Fat                        3.4 g
Saturated                        0.5 g
Polyunsaturated            0.6 g
Monounsaturated            0.1 g
Cholesterol                        0.0 mg
Sodium                        47.2 mg
Potassium                        28.6 mg
Total Carbohydrate            15.0 g
Dietary Fiber                        0.9 g
Sugars                                    9.7 g
Protein                                    4.4 g

GOAT
From Dictionary.com:
Get one’s Goat, Informal – to anger, annoy, or frustrate a person.

CrossFit definition (from CF Montgomery County):
“Your “goat” is the movement, task, or thing that kicks your ass above all others. Not the thing you like the least or the movement that tires you out the fastest, but the thing that strikes dread in your heart when you see it in the WOD because you struggle with every single rep or you can’t do it at all yet.” Not to far off!

The bottom line is this; CrossFit prepares all individuals for the unknown and unknowable. “The needs of our elderly and the needs of the soldier differ in degree – not kind” Coach Greg Glassman. CrossFit workouts also differ in degree – not kind; everyone does the same workout each day, the difference is that we are able to modify each workout to an individual’s needs and capabilities. Whether you are older fighting to stay out of the old folk’s home, a soldier fighting for your country, or a parent reacting to your kids who are in danger, you want to be physically and mentally able to conquer the unknowable tasks that present you each and everyday.

This brings us back to our goats. We all have them, it’s a question of weather or not we are willing to attack them head on. If you are, you will develop your overall athleticism and mental toughness. CrossFit has proven that developing things you suck at will improve your abilities at the things you are already good at. The fewer goats you have in the gym and in life the better you are and the more prepared you will be for the unexpected.
